The relationship remains in effect after background copying completes.
Data can be written to the T-VOL. Subsequent changes are tracked so

YTW

that future operations are performed incrementally. This relationship
continues until explicitly terminated with a Withdraw request.

Note: The target is writable while the incremental relationship is active.
Any writes done to the target during this period are overwritten if a
subsequent increment is done, keeping the target a true copy of the
source. If the relationship is reversed, the changes made to the target are
reflected on the source.
